AMBA Stock Analysis - Frequently Asked Questions

Ambarella's stock was trading at $70.84 at the start of the year. Since then, AMBA shares have decreased by 9.5% and is now trading at $64.11.

Ambarella, Inc. (NASDAQ:AMBA) announced its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, May, 28th. The semiconductor company reported $0.11 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, meeting the consensus estimate of $0.11. The company's quarterly revenue was up 16.9% on a year-over-year basis.

Ambarella (AMBA) raised $60 million in an initial public offering (IPO) on Wednesday, October 10th 2012. The company issued 6,000,000 shares at $9.00-$11.00 per share.

Top institutional shareholders of Ambarella include The Manufacturers Life Insurance Company (3.62%), Dimensional Fund Advisors LP (1.46%), Bank of America Corp DE (1.10%) and Stephens Investment Management Group LLC (1.09%). Insiders that own company stock include Leslie Kohn, Feng-Ming Wang, Chi-Hong Ju, Chi-Hong Ju, Chan W Lee, John Alexander Young, Yun-Lung Chen, Christopher B Paisley, Hsiao-Wuen Hon, David Jeffrey Richardson, Christopher Day and Elizabeth M Schwarting.
